1. About TwoHearths
TwoHearths is a family wellbeing app designed to help children record how their days felt, later reflections, transition feelings through Journey with Tim, Worry Stones and Help Requests.
TwoHearths is designed around the child first. It is not a medical, diagnostic, counselling, safeguarding, legal or forensic service and it does not decide why a child felt something, whether an event happened, or whether one parent or home is better than another.

3. Child privacy and Worry Stones
Worry Stones are private by default. A child may choose to keep a Worry Stone private, share it with one or more selected grown ups, or send a Help Request to a chosen grown up.
A Help Request does not automatically disclose what the child wrote on a private Worry Stone. Sharing with one grown up does not automatically share the same information with every grown up in the family.

6. Reports
A grown up may be able to create a Common Wellbeing Report from information recorded in TwoHearths. Private Worry Stones are not included in the normal Common Wellbeing Report, and recipient specific shared information is kept separately.
A report can show what was recorded. It does not independently prove that an event happened, establish why a child felt something, assign cause or blame, diagnose a child, assess quality of care, or rank one Hearth against another.
7. Report integrity and verification
TwoHearths may create a SHA 256 fingerprint from the canonical dataset used for a report and may create an export receipt with a server generated creation time.
The fingerprint is an integrity mechanism, not a statement of factual truth. The public verification page is informational only and is not a public lookup service for child or family data.
